Private sector jobs fell in Wisconsin in June

Order Reprint

The number of private sector jobs in Wisconsin fell in June by 11,700 and the state’s unemployment rate climbed to 7.0 percent from 6.8 percent in May, according to the latest seasonally adjusted data released today by the Department of Workforce Development.

The department also revised the estimated number of private sector jobs in Wisconsin in May to 2,328,000, up 1,200 from 2,326,800.
The employment sector sustaining the largest drop in jobs in June was service providing sector. The leisure and hospitality sector also lost 5,300 jobs.
The estimates were provided by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ics.
